Chinese Fried Rice with Shrimp

Ingredients: (Serves 4)
  • 4 c. cold cooked rice
  • 2 tbsp. oil
  • 2 onions, chopped
  • 2 c. shrimp, shelled and deveined
  • 1-2 eggs, slightly beaten
  • 1 c. mushrooms, sautéed
  • 1/2 tsp. salt
  • 1/2 tsp. pepper
  • 2 tbsp. soy sauce
  • Chopped scallions 

Directions:
  1. Heat oil in wok. Add onions and lightly brown.
  2. Add shrimp. Add salt and pepper to beaten eggs and pour over shrimp and onions; scramble together.
  3. Add mushrooms, soy sauce and cold rice. Heat until rice is hot, stirring occasionally to keep from sticking. Sprinkle chopped scallions on top.

    Note: Ham, chicken or veal may be substituted for shrimp.
